The Role

Atlas Growth is a cloud engineering group whose mission is to guide customers through their app development journey—from cluster configuration, data modeling and load testing, to running a production workload at scale. We use an in-house experiments platform which helps us validate our features quickly, releasing only the work that positively impacts our customers. Our engineers participate in cross-functional “squads” with product, design, analytics, and research focusing on a single metric (e.g. retention). Our engineering team is part of a larger Atlas Core Engineering org, building foundational elements of MongoDB’s developer data platform.

Atlas Growth 2 builds customer-facing features in Atlas and sits alongside other Growth engineering teams. Recent projects include a personalized landing page for Atlas, a recommendation system that offers tips for better database performance, and a pricing page designed to optimize conversion rates.

Role Overview

Atlas Growth 2 seeks a Senior Software Engineer. Senior engineers lead complex projects, provide mentorship to teammates, and shape the technical direction of our team. They are expected to proactively suggest and implement improvements to our product, processes, and infrastructure, in addition to leading their projects.

Candidate Profile
  • 6+ years of software engineering experience
  • Fluency in TypeScript and JavaScript
  • Proficiency in Java, Go, C++/C, or a similar compiled language
  • Experience writing database queries and indexes—either document-based or relational
  • Experience writing and reviewing technical specs 
  • Interest in A/B testing or product design
  • Familiarity with Kubernetes and container architecture
  • Track record of designing, releasing, and monitoring highly complex features
  • Experience with on call rotations
Expectations
  • Contribute readable, well-tested, and debuggable code
  • Work closely with product management to assess feasibility of upcoming projects and guide long-term roadmap of customer-facing features
  • Write scope and technical spec docs for large projects assigned by your manager. Lead small working groups of two or three engineers for these projects
  • Provide well-reasoned, thorough review of the team’s code and technical documentation
  • Take ownership of a particular domain and make a plan to improve that area
  • Offer informal mentorship to your peers
